Ron Burkle Cuts Stake in American Apparel (APP)
Shares of American Apparel Inc. (AMEX: APP) are falling in the after-hours trade after Ron Burkle reported that he has cut his stake in the company. Currently shares are off by 5.17%, trading at $1.10; shares ended the regular session higher by 16.00%, trading at $1.16.
American Apparel, Inc. is a vertically-integrated manufacturer, distributor and retailer of branded fashion basic apparel. The company designs, manufactures and sells clothing for women, men, children and pets through retail, wholesale and online distribution channels.
